Web21 jun. 2024 · Anticholinergic Burden and Most Common Anticholinergic-acting Medicines in Older General Practice Patients eCollection 2024 Jun. Authors Eva Gorup 1 … WebThe most common ADS anticholinergic was furosemide (5.8%) and the most common ACB anticholinergic was metformin (13.7%). The majority of the identified anticholinergics were drugs with low anticholinergic potential: 80.2% (ADS) and 73.4% (ACB), respectively. Web21 jun. 2024 · Anticholinergic burden refers to the cumulative effects of taking multiple medications with desired or undesired anticholinergic effects. 1 Anticholinergic drugs are associated with delirium, 2 cognitive decline, 3 falls risk 4 and mortality 5 including increased all-cause mortality risk specifically in persons with dementia. 5

Web30 jun. 2024 · Purpose The cumulative effect of medication inhibiting acetylcholine activity—also known as anticholinergic burden (AB)—can lead to functional and cognitive decline, falls, and death. Given that studies on the population prevalence of AB are rare, we aimed to describe it in a large and unselected population sample.
